I have a checklist that I review with pet owners to ensure we cover everything as thoroughly as possible. This includes bathroom schedules, allergies, medications, the type of fencing or yard setup they have, whether pets are allowed on furniture, and if they are sensitive to thunder or loud noises (primarily so I can monitor them closely during storms or fireworks). I also ask about grooming needs, any injuries or hotspots to watch for, veterinary contact information, and the nearest emergency vet in your area. While I’ve never had to take a pet I was caring for to an emergency vet, I believe it’s important to have that information readily available in case treatment ever becomes necessary. We’ll also discuss any limitations they may have, as well as whether they’re allowed to go on rides, walks, swimming outings, or even enjoy the occasional pup cup 🩶 I also like to review each pet’s daily routine and preferences with owners to help keep their care as consistent and comfortable as possible while you’re away. I’ll ask about feeding schedules, potty breaks, medications, sleeping arrangements, favorite activities, and any behaviors or sensitivities I should be aware of.
